Summary of the Inventive Concept

The present inventive concept discloses novel melphalan formulations adapted for use in emergency response scenarios, disaster relief, high-security needs, and extreme weather conditions, addressing the limitations of conventional formulations in these contexts.

Background and Problem Solved

Conventional melphalan formulations are often limited by their instability, requiring refrigeration and specialized storage, which hinders their use in emergency response, disaster relief, and extreme environments. The original patent provides stable ready-to-use injectable formulations of melphalan, but these formulations are not specifically designed for the unique challenges of these niche applications.

Detailed Description of the Inventive Concept

The present inventive concept encompasses a range of melphalan formulations tailored for specific operational environments. For example, a portable container stores a ready-to-use injectable formulation of melphalan for emergency response, while a tamper-evident container with secure authentication ensures high-security storage. The inventive concept also includes weather-resistant delivery devices for administering melphalan in extreme weather conditions, and pressure-resistant containers for use in high-altitude environments.

Obviousness Rationale

A person having ordinary skill in the art would recognize that the emergency response and specialized environment adaptations of the melphalan formulation represent predictable variations of the original stable injectable formulation. The core chemical composition remains substantially unchanged, with modifications focusing on packaging, delivery mechanisms, and contextual adaptability. These variations represent standard engineering design choices within pharmaceutical product development that would be obvious to a skilled practitioner seeking to extend the utility of an existing medical formulation.
